1828 Definition

WICKEDLY, adv. IN a manner or with motives and designs contrary to the divine law; viciously; corruptly; immorally.

All that do wickedly shall be stubble. Malachi 4.

I have sinned, and I have done wickedly. 2 Samuel 24.
1913 Definition
Wickedly (wickedly)
adv.
Wick"ed*ly
  1. In a wicked manner; in a manner, or with motives and designs, contrary to the divine law or the law of morality; viciously; corruptly; immorally.

    I have sinned, and I have done wickedly. 2 Sam. xxiv. 17.
